Online vidoes are great collection of information about the world. Here is a collection of most important online video sites.

List of Video Sharing Sites


This is a list of videos sharing sites that I could find in the internet. My focus would be on the free video sharing sites & those that I've tried myself.

The number one would be 'Youtube' though it wasn't the first one created. But it was the first one that caught on with the masses. Starting off with the list would be Google Video, Yahoo & even MSN and then lesser known sites.

Some sites existed for years earlier than 'Youtube' and have very strong fan base. Some of the have better loading time & videos are easy to download.

Try out all of them & you might find the right video sharing site for you.

Hidden Gems & why?
1. Veoh - By downloading VeohTV Beta you can download high quality videos easily & plays them using any media player like PowerDVD, WinAmp, Window Player. I used it personally to download high quality Japanese anime.

2. Vuze - Another video sharing where you can download high definition videos. Good for those who looks for documentaries, music videos and even mature contents. Need to download Vuze Downloader.

3. Tudou - A famous China site that seem to goes under the radar; undetected for publishing full scale movies. Here you can find the latest movies before spending your money on the DVD or the movie tickets. However, site are in Chinese & you've got to have some sense to go around it.
